AMD Radeon HD 7970 GHz Edition vs ATI FirePro V3900

We compared two Desktop platform GPUs: 3GB VRAM Radeon HD 7970 GHz Edition and 1024MB VRAM FirePro V3900 to see which GPU has better performance in key specifications, benchmark tests, power consumption, etc.

Main Differences

AMD Radeon HD 7970 GHz Edition 's Advantages
Boost Clock1050MHz
More VRAM (3GB vs 1GB)
Larger VRAM bandwidth (288.0GB/s vs 28.80GB/s)
1568 additional rendering cores
ATI FirePro V3900 's Advantages
Lower TDP (50W vs 300W)
